what's up w/ this engine

looking through cl and this came up- 1997 Celica GT, what's up w/ the engine- is that thing a filter, can it be replaced w/ a standard filter? From looking at the photo is there any missing or modified that influence performance, or the way the car will run and sound- I'm not completely familiar w/ what a 94-99 celica engine looks like, is that an ABS pump/box in the lower left corner near the windshield fluid?

yeah its a housing for an air filter, you could probably just pull a stock airbox if you wanted to go back. Also there's a header. Check the exhaust, if this was mated to the stock exhaust, it likely eliminated the catalytic converter.

The ABS controller is in the lower left with the metal tubing coming from the top. The cruise control box gets moved next to the battery when you have ABS.

You are looking at a 3rd Revolution 5S-FE. Should look similar to below, they have a modified exhaust header without the heat shield. I agree with Rob, they've likely cut out the cat.

on that engine you dont have to cut ou the cat it is bolted to the manifold and is removed when equiping an ebay header.
